Structure

The PGCE Postgraduate Teacher Apprenticeship is structured over a two-year period, with a blend of theoretical coursework and practical experience. The program consists of several modules that cover essential topics such as Foundations of Learning, Literacy and Numeracy, Curriculum Development, and Educational Psychology. Students will engage in a combination of lectures, seminars, and workshops, complemented by significant classroom placements to apply theoretical knowledge in practice. The apprenticeship also includes opportunities for optional placements in diverse educational settings, enhancing your ability to adapt to various teaching environments. By integrating classroom experience with academic study, this course ensures that graduates are well-prepared to meet the challenges of primary education head-on. Students will have access to a supportive mentoring system throughout their apprenticeship, facilitating both personal and professional development.

Entry Requirements

To be eligible for the PGCE Postgraduate Teacher Apprenticeship, applicants typically need a Bachelor’s degree, ideally with a minimum classification of 2:2. Additionally, candidates must demonstrate proficiency in English, meeting the required standards such as IELTS 6.5 or TOEFL 90. Relevant experience in working with children, particularly in educational settings, is also highly regarded. Prospective students should be prepared to comply with all safeguarding requirements, including an Enhanced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) check. This rigorous selection process ensures that successful candidates are not only academically qualified but also possess the necessary interpersonal skills to engage effectively in the classroom.
